From The G-Man has published numerous commentaries and reports on the conditions, policies and practices that are allegedly having an adverse effect on the health and safety of Krystal Clark and others at the Women’s Huron Valley Correctional Facility (WHV). The special investigative series was launched in 2021 with the assistance of Prison Radio.
During the nearly three-year period, From The G-Man contacted the office of Governor Whitmer and submitted several of the aforementioned reports. There has been no response from Whitmer or her spokesperson. In 2023, Prison Radio told From The G-Man that State Representatives Amos O’Neal, who represents the 94th House District, and Jimmie Wilson,Jr., serving the 32nd House District, would be visiting the facility. From The G-Man spoke with both offices, and they confirmed the officials would visit the prison. However, they could not confirm the date of the visitation.
On October 16 of 2023, a source at the Women’s Huron Valley Correctional Facility told From The G-Man that the elected officials never visited the prison. Krystal Clark confirmed this during an August 2024 phone conversation with From The G-Man, and arrangements are being made to have her son appear on The G-Man Interviews to provide details on how prison officials and doctors are allegedly targeting his mother for speaking out and repeatedly violating her civil rights.
Activist Paula Kensu recently submitted the following letter to WHV Warden Jeremy Howard and Assistant Warden Horton via email. Kensu has played a key role in the ongoing effort to make the public aware of Clark’s plight and deteriorating health.

Warden Howard/Assistant Warden Horton:
Can you please tell me why Krystal Clark was not returned to her regular cell in Harrison A and instead placed in Filmore B after her retaliatory transfer for nine days into a single cell with feces, vomit and urine on the floor and walls and no shower for the first four days? As you are aware, Filmore B is the filthiest unit in the prison and where the mold is the worse. It’s where the drinking fountains were shut down for mold problems, yesterday, and residents were told to drink out of their sinks. The water comes from the same source, so if one is not safe neither is the other. Officers refuse to drink that water.
Krystal is a unit rep in Harrison and per the policy, she should have been returned to her unit after coming back from that solo cell/punishment that you locked her up for nine days in. She didn’t have a major ticket nor was she voted out. If she did or was, please provide proof. Otherwise, return her to her cell. Please make sure you don’t shack her up with a druggie either, as you know she doesn’t use drugs or want to be around them.
I’m continuing to document all of the retaliation from the staff, including medical officers (Ellison and DON Jones, as well as K. Carter and PA Reed. Although they may not be copied here, please put them on notice. You will all be listed in a civil rights lawsuit as complicit in denying care and cruel and degrading conditions and treatment. She has not caused any problems. She has only requested medical care to treat her symptoms from mold allergies and asked for her shampoo, soap, wheelchair and antibiotics. Instead she has been met with the worst retaliation I’ve ever seen.
